VR virtual reality technology could allow one to talk to the characters in the anime. Through VR equipment (such as VR helmets, gloves, etc.), users could enter a virtual space and experience the same visual and auditory effects as anime characters. In this environment, users could interact with virtual characters in real time, listen to their voices, and see their expressions and actions.
For example, a VR gamer could talk to a virtual character through a VR helmet. They could say the name of the virtual character and ask if they needed help. The virtual characters would respond to their messages and answer their questions. In this way, the user could have a deeper understanding of the character's personality and background.
Another great VR anime story is '.hack//Sign'. It delves deep into the concept of a virtual world and the psychological effects on the players. Tsukasa, the main character, gets trapped in 'The World' and has to figure out how to escape while dealing with various in - game mysteries and other players.
The VR game experience in the anime Sword God Domain was mainly achieved through virtual reality technology. In VR games, players could enter a completely virtual world by wearing VR helmets and gloves to experience a different game experience from the real world.
VR games usually had a large number of scenes and props that players could freely explore and interact with. At the same time, the VR game also provided various missions and challenges. Players could interact with other players in the game or engage in autonomous battles.
In VR games, players could also enhance the game experience through various interaction methods, such as voice calls, Gesture Recognition, and so on. The virtual world in VR games could also be customized according to the needs of the players, allowing them to have a more personal gaming experience.
Generally speaking, the VR game experience in the anime Sword God Domain was a very unique and interesting way for players to enter a completely virtual world and experience a different game experience from the real world.
